I just went to Shapiro's in Indianapolis for the first time in years, and it's as good as ever. This time I took my dad - a native New Yorker and a tough critic of corned beef - to see what he thought. He agreed with me that the corned beef was better than any he'd had in the Midwest - even better than Manny's in Chicago. He also praised the rye bread, which was thick with nice crunchy edges. Definitely a million times better than the packaged stuff now used at even some NY delis. The chicken soup was excellent, as was the potato pancake and strawberry rhubarb pie. I wish it wasn't four hours away! Or maybe it's better that way -I'd weigh 300 pounds if it was here.
